Event Recap

Rising Tides brought together over 100 artists from around the world for a powerful exhibition and fundraiser supporting ocean conservation through art.

Presented by PangeaSeed, the event celebrated creativity as a force for awareness, connection, and environmental action. Inside and around 111 Minna Gallery, the exhibition connected original artwork, fine art prints, storytelling, and community-driven experiences with a mission rooted in ocean advocacy.

Featuring work from a diverse international lineup, Rising Tides highlighted the beauty, urgency, and emotional power of our relationship with the ocean. Through painting, printmaking, visual storytelling, and public engagement, the exhibition reflected PangeaSeed’s mission to turn environmental science into accessible, inspiring calls to action.

Proceeds supported PangeaSeed’s ongoing efforts in ocean advocacy, public art, and education, making the collection an opportunity for guests and collectors to bring meaningful work into their own spaces while supporting a vital cause.
